Key Topics

  • Understand emerging trends in AI, green tech, and cybersecurity and see why skills—not job titles—are the best indicator of labor market evolution.

  • See how Gies College of Business uses skills data to design and market career-aligned credentials for working professionals.

  • See how Cerritos College uses labor market information to anticipate trends and help faculty prepare for emerging industry needs.

Today, in-demand skills are evolving faster than ever. Over the past three years, one-third of the skills required for the average job have changed—transforming industries, disrupting talent pipelines, and challenging educators and policymakers to keep up. This webinar, based on findings from our recent report, The Speed of Skill Change, explores how colleges and universities are responding to these trends, and offers actionable strategies to stay ahead.
